Learning Outcomes
The student will be taught the skills, and application of these, required of a manager, in particular in relation the healthcare scientists working in Transfusion, Transplantation & Tissue Banking. Specific instruction will be given in time management, delegation, motivation of staff, coaching, mentoring and training.
The use of these skills in problem solving, operational planning, change management and team building will be addressed and communication skills will be further developed along with approaches to personal development planning.
